How to implement conditional query in php: first call the previously encapsulated class; then use keyword fuzzy query; then create a form, submit the data to the current page, extract the keyword query; and finally use PHP code Traverse the elements in the table and turn the keywords into red.
Recommended: "PHP Video Tutorial"
1. Single condition Query is a query with only one condition:
1. First call the previously encapsulated class, and then use keywords to fuzzy query:
2. Create a form, submit the data to the current page, and extract the keyword query:
姓名 | 性别 | 班级 | ||
{$str} | {$v[2]} | {$v[4]} |
代号 | 名称 | 系列 | 上市时间 | 价格 |
2. Call the encapsulation class, create corresponding conditions, and check whether the data is empty :
3. Use PHP code to traverse the database table and turn the keywords into red (php should be embedded in the table):
query($sql);foreach($arr as $v) { $str = str_replace($name,"{$name}",$v[1]); echo "";}?> {$v[0]} {$str} {$v[2]} {$v[3]} {$v[7]}
The final result is:
The above is the detailed content of How to implement conditional query in php. For more information, please follow other related articles on the PHP Chinese website!